Like you, I have all of the IPR symptoms. I found one change which has helped quite a lot. I drink decaf coffee at breakfast and the one change that I made was to make it using the cold drip method. So instead of brewing it in a coffee maker in the morning, I make a pitcher of it using the cold drip method and store it in refrigerator. Then I pour a cup in the morning and microwave it to warm it. It has practically eliminated all of the coughing I was doing every morning. This method removes most of the acid from the coffee.
